#78f490 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#78f490 is composed of 47.1% red, 95.7%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 41%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 131.6 degrees, a saturation of 84.9% and a lightness of 71.4%. #78f490 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ffff with #00e921.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#78f490 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#78f490 has RGB values of R:120, G:244,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 7926928.

Shades and Tints of #78f490
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a03 is the darkest color, while #f7f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#78f490
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6b6b6 is the less saturated color, while #72fa8d is the most saturated one.
